Understanding Emotional Damages in Warehouse Accidents
Emotional damages refer to non-financial losses that individuals experience as a result of traumatic events, such as warehouse accidents. Beyond physical injuries and medical bills, victims may suffer from severe emotional trauma, which can significantly impact their daily lives. This includes conditions like depression, anxiety, post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), and other mental health issues. When these damages occur due to someone else’s negligence or recklessness in a warehouse setting, it’s crucial for affected individuals to understand their rights.
